改进的快速短时傅里叶变换算法在跳频信号分析中的应用

摘    要:考虑到哈特莱变换对于实信号频谱分析的高效性,在分析哈特莱变换与傅里叶变换相互关系的基础上,给出了离散哈特莱变换(FHT)基2算法的推导,并将其计算量与FFT算法进行了比较,最后应用高效的离散哈特莱变换(FHT)基2算法对快速跳频信号进行了STFT时频分析。仿真结果表明该方法能够有效地分析随时间快速跳变的跳频信号。通过比较可以看出该算法运算量较小,可有效节约运算时间,适合于快速跳频信号的实时分析和跟踪干扰。

关 键 词:跳频  哈特莱变换  傅里叶变换  时频分析

Application of a Modified Fast STFT Method in Frequency Hopping Signals Analysis

Abstract:Considering Hartley transform's effectiveness in analyzing frequency spectrum of real signal,this paper analyzes the relations of DHT and DFT,inferres radix-2 FHT algorithm from the definition of DHT,and compares its amount of calculation with FFT algorithm.At last,fast frequency hopping signals is analyzed using STFT time-frequency method based on radix-2 FHT algorithm.The simulation results show that it is effective to analyze fast frequency hopping signal in both time and frequency domains by using this method.The comparition shows this algorithm can reduce computation,save operation time and is suitable for real-time analyzing and tracking jamming of frequency hopping signals.
Keywords:frequency hopping signals   Hartley transform  Fourier transform   time-frequency analysis
